Kulkarni’s career began as a lead field engineer in India, where she honed her skills in optimizing operations and driving revenue growth for major energy clients. Her experience working on complex exploration and production projects laid the foundation for her later innovations. Recognizing a critical gap in data management within the oil and gas industry, Kulkarni shifted her focus to developing and implementing a global digital platform for Baker Hughes. This platform revolutionized pricing strategies, sales processes, and account management, demonstrating the potential for digital transformation in a traditionally analog industry.

Kulkarni identified the need for a centralized data system while managing an unconventional fracturing campaign. The lack of readily accessible pricing information and historical data hampered efficient decision-making. This led her to envision a centralized contract repository with detailed pricing information, linked to invoicing and market intelligence. This innovative platform empowered sales and commercial teams to develop data-driven strategies, significantly improving efficiency and win rates for tenders.

The digital platform developed by Kulkarni provides a comprehensive view of market trends and customer behavior, allowing for more informed pricing decisions and optimized product portfolios. This data-driven approach contrasts sharply with the traditional reliance on spreadsheets and fragmented information, enabling faster, more accurate, and more effective sales strategies. The platform also automates reporting, reduces price leakage, and enhances overall operational efficiency. It allows for the integration of AI and machine learning tools, further amplifying its impact on the business. Kulkarni’s transition from petroleum engineering to digital leadership highlights the importance of continuous learning and adaptability in today’s rapidly evolving technological landscape. She pursued professional development through programs like Rice University’s Global Energy Leadership program, expanding her knowledge base and strengthening her leadership skills. While her background is in petroleum engineering, Kulkarni acquired the necessary software engineering principles through self-study, industry networking, and a deep understanding of business needs.
